diff options
author | Chris Lattner <sabre@nondot.org> | 2009-09-08 23:05:44 +0000 |
---|---|---|
committer | Chris Lattner <sabre@nondot.org> | 2009-09-08 23:05:44 +0000 |
commit | d842962e27b10b6831c2421fa257e3fd58a85b18 (patch) | |
tree | f21109ac541738051fdd3e258c078bafa09d40c6 /test/CodeGen/X86/remat-mov-1.ll | |
parent | 9c7a988e3b014ed56e6765f9ceb68d80d56414c0 (diff) | |
download | external_llvm-d842962e27b10b6831c2421fa257e3fd58a85b18.zip external_llvm-d842962e27b10b6831c2421fa257e3fd58a85b18.tar.gz external_llvm-d842962e27b10b6831c2421fa257e3fd58a85b18.tar.bz2 |
change selectiondag to add the sign extended versions of immediate operands
to instructions instead of zero extended ones. This makes the asmprinter
print signed values more consistently. This apparently only really affects
the X86 backend.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@81265 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'test/CodeGen/X86/remat-mov-1.ll')
-rw-r--r-- | test/CodeGen/X86/remat-mov-1.ll |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/test/CodeGen/X86/remat-mov-1.ll b/test/CodeGen/X86/remat-mov-1.ll index 98b7bb4..569b14e 100644 --- a/test/CodeGen/X86/remat-mov-1.ll +++ b/test/CodeGen/X86/remat-mov-1.ll @@ -1,4 +1,4 @@ -; RUN: llvm-as < %s | llc -march=x86 | grep 4294967295 | grep mov | count 2 +; RUN: llvm-as < %s | llc -march=x86 | grep -- -1 | grep mov | count 2 %struct.FILE = type { i8*, i32, i32, i16, i16, %struct.__sbuf, i32, i8*, i32 (i8*)*, i32 (i8*, i8*, i32)*, i64 (i8*, i64, i32)*, i32 (i8*, i8*, i32)*, %struct.__sbuf, %struct.__sFILEX*, i32, [3 x i8], [1 x i8], %struct.__sbuf, i32, i64 } %struct.ImgT = type { i8, i8*, i8*, %struct.FILE*, i32, i32, i32, i32, i8*, double*, float*, float*, float*, i32*, double, double, i32*, double*, i32*, i32* } |